- 17 Feb, 2011 2 commits
-
-
Poul-Henning Kamp authored
so I added one NUL too many to enum spec strings, preventing any subsequent args from being handled correctly. Spotted by: Nils Goroll
-
Poul-Henning Kamp authored
Make the default VCL explictly set the TTL to two minutes, decoupling it from the default_ttl parameter. This makes it clear that hit-for-pass happens, and makes it possible to avoid the hit-for-pass object, (ie: get a plain pass) by setting its ttl to zero in vcl_fetch.
-
- 15 Feb, 2011 15 commits
-
-
Poul-Henning Kamp authored
-
Poul-Henning Kamp authored
-
Poul-Henning Kamp authored
position of the "last" bit in the included ESI object.
-
Poul-Henning Kamp authored
If an esi-processed job starts with <esi:include without any preceeding verbatim bytes, we would not emit the gzip header until after the included file.
-
Poul-Henning Kamp authored
with/without leading and training verbatim data.
-
Poul-Henning Kamp authored
preceeding verbatim bytes, we would not emit the gzip header until after the included file. Instead force the gzip header out as SKIP and inject a synthetic one where needed during delivery.
-
Poul-Henning Kamp authored
-
Poul-Henning Kamp authored
-
-
Poul-Henning Kamp authored
-
Tollef Fog Heen authored
Optional libedit support to varnishadm. No saving of history or completion yet.
-
Poul-Henning Kamp authored
workspace either.
-
Poul-Henning Kamp authored
-
Poul-Henning Kamp authored
runs into trouble when we reset the workspace as part of ESI:include processing. Fixes: #861
-
Poul-Henning Kamp authored
maintain proper ordering.
-
- 11 Feb, 2011 5 commits
-
-
Poul-Henning Kamp authored
minimum demanded by the system.
-
Poul-Henning Kamp authored
this works better with Solaris
-
Poul-Henning Kamp authored
a smarter compiler than GCC could have seen through.
-
-
Poul-Henning Kamp authored
Fortunately there is a backstop, so worst case a request would just fail. Spotted by: Erik Missed by: phk, twice
-
- 10 Feb, 2011 2 commits
-
-
Ingvar Hagelund authored
-
Ingvar Hagelund authored
-
- 09 Feb, 2011 10 commits
-
-
Poul-Henning Kamp authored
-
Poul-Henning Kamp authored
-
Poul-Henning Kamp authored
-
Poul-Henning Kamp authored
-
Poul-Henning Kamp authored
Now it does.
-
Poul-Henning Kamp authored
The lock order is lru->exp lock, so that the timer_index can be safely examined while holding only the lru lock, eliminating the need for the separate OC_F_ONLRU flag. The critical trick is that in EXP_Touch() the lru_lock is sufficient: We just move the object around on the lru list, we don't add or delete it. This hopefully reduces lock contention on these locks.
-
Poul-Henning Kamp authored
process.
-
Poul-Henning Kamp authored
-
Poul-Henning Kamp authored
whatever storage we have put the object into.
-
Poul-Henning Kamp authored
caught it, he would always say "Just checking if you were paying attention". I guess Erik Inge Bolsø was :-)
-
- 08 Feb, 2011 6 commits
-
-
Kristian Lyngstol authored
-
Poul-Henning Kamp authored
-
Poul-Henning Kamp authored
-
Poul-Henning Kamp authored
ones that later may find usage in a separate silo-maintenance utility.
-
Poul-Henning Kamp authored
-
Poul-Henning Kamp authored
-